Speech-language Therapy and Mental Health Counseling

Speech-language therapy and mental health counseling are distinct yet complementary fields that focus on improving overall quality of life.  Speech-language therapy treats all manner of communication and swallowing disorders, while mental health counseling addresses emotional, behavioral, and psychological issues, such as anxiety and depression.

At Our Space Family Counseling, speech-language pathologists (SLP) and mental health counselors (MHC) take a team approach in supporting individuals who can profit from this dual strategy.  Adults, teens and children with emotional, psychological, and interpersonal relationship issues, as well as behavioral challenges, can often benefit from improved communication skills.

The need for these services at times intersect, as communication challenges can be a factor in mental health struggles (e.g., anxiety from stuttering) and mental health issues can affect communication, as is often the case in selective mutism.  In such instances, our team of professionals collaborate to provide holistic care, ensuring our clients can both understand their emotions and articulate them.
